Who Is Responsible for Damages in School Bus Accident Claims?

Proving responsibility for an Albuquerque school bus accident and holding guilty parties liable for the consequences is complicated. Public schools oversee the operation of most school buses. Since they are a government agency, they may be protected from liability by a type of immunity. A skilled attorney could help you understand who can be held liable and when.

School Bus Drivers

The bus driver may be found at fault if the accident was caused by their negligent actions, such as failure to operate the bus properly or not following traffic laws. When the driver is at fault, the school district may be held liable.

School Districts

If the school bus driver is found responsible for the accident, the school district might be held liable as the driver’s employer. This is even more likely when a bus driver has a poor driving record or previous concerns.

Other Drivers

If another driver collides with the school bus due to their negligent actions, they can be found liable for all injuries that occur in the accident. Common reasons a negligent driver may cause a school bus accident include distracted driving and speeding.

School Bus Manufacturer

If a defect in a school bus design causes an accident or contributes to an accident, the vehicle’s manufacturer could be held liable for injuries.

Recoverable Damages After a School Bus Accident

Compensation awarded to Albuquerque families of children in a school bus accident can cover financial and non-economic damages. The types of damages awarded depend on the circumstances of the accident. Recoverable damages may include the following.

  • Current and future medical bills for treatment of injuries sustained in the accident
  • Pain and suffering, including physical pain and psychological trauma caused by the accident
  • Rehabilitation and other treatment costs
  • Lost wages while out of work caring for an injured child
  • Special education requirements while a child is out of school for recovery
  • Home or vehicle modifications to assist with long-term or permanent injuries
